All I read is that the diving in Sharm is great, but there will be 20 other jumbo dive boats all packed in the same area....

Egyptian divers tell me to go to Dahab for diving as good with far less crowds.

You have heard correctly. The reef gets fishing nets and lobster pots dragged across it daily. There are very very few large fish. My best suggestion is to try a night dive while there, it seems that there are many more things to see there at night vs day. My guess is that the fishermen don't go out at night, so those species have a better chance.
